§ 78.570 — Sale of property and franchise under decree of court

Nevada·Title 7 BUSINESS ASSOCIATIONS; SECURITIES; COMMODITIES·Ch. 78 Private· SALE OF ASSETS; DISSOLUTION AND WINDING UP
Sales of the property and franchises of corporations that may be sold under a decree of court shall be made after such notice of the time and place as the court may deem proper. If the sales are made in the foreclosure of one or more mortgages, the court may order the sale to be made for the whole amount of indebtedness secured by the mortgage or mortgages, or for the amount of interest due under the mortgage or mortgages, subject to the payment by the purchaser of the outstanding indebtedness and interest secured thereby as they become due. In the latter event the court may, by proper orders, secure the assumption thereof by the purchaser.
